[0021] The slab continuous casting mold powder specially used for high-strength steel containing vanadium (V), niobium (Nb) and titanium (Ti) of the present invention is composed of base material (pre-melted material), flux material, alkalinity adjustment material and It is composed of carbonaceous materials, and their weight percentages are: pre-melted material 78-85, flux material 5-12, alkalinity adjustment material 5-10, carbonaceous material 2-6; the flux material includes Li 2 CO 3 , MgCO 3 , MnCO 3 And NaF, the Li 2 CO 3 , MgCO 3 , MnCO 3 The weight percentages of NaF and NaF in the mold flux are 2.1-8%, 1.3-4.8%, 1.5-8.5%, 2.0-7.0%, respectively.

Abstract

The invention relates to a specific mould powder of crystallization mould of high strength steel containing V, Nb, Ti of slab costing and a production process thereof. The mould powder comprises pre-melted raw materials, flux materials, alkalinity adjustment materials and carbonaceous materials, and the weight percentages are that: 78-85 percent of pre-melted raw materials, 5-12 percent of flux materials, 5-10 percent of alkalinity adjustment materials and 2-6 percent carbonaceous materials; the production process of the invention is: various qualified materials are crushed to appropriate size and sent into a furnace; water quenching is carried out to the material taken out from the furnace; then gasification is done and sent into a pre-melted material storehouse. The qualified pre-melted raw materials, flux materials, alkalinity adjustment materials and carbonaceous materials are made to be gasified and sent into the material storehouse to be burdened, then sent into a mixer; a semi-finished product is made to be tested, if qualified, sent into a ball mill to be dry ground and into a water mill to be finely ground, so as to make slurry; the next steps are material extraction, spraying, product testing, packaging and storing. The production of the invention has the advantages that product has little slag strip; the spreading property of the crystallization mould is good; reaction inside the crystallization mould is active with small flame.

Description

Technical field [0001] The invention relates to a slab continuous casting mold powder for high-strength steel containing vanadium (V), niobium (Nb) and titanium (Ti) and its production process. Background technique [0002] At present, most domestic high-grade steel products still rely on imports, among which high-strength steel containing V, Ni, and Ti is one of them. The main reason is that the domestic steelmaking, continuous casting level and the quality of the corresponding supporting materials have not yet reached the corresponding requirements. Among the supporting materials, mold powder is one of the key materials. [0003] The main purpose of introducing V, Nb, and Ti into steel is to refine the grains, increase the strength of the steel, and optimize the performance of the steel.
